About M Condorelli

M Condorelli is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Surgery, Physiology, Molecular Biology and Complementary and alternative medicine, having authored 265 papers that have together received 6.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Heart Rate Variability and Autonomic Control (37 papers),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(32 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(27 papers),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(24 papers), Cardiovascular and exercise physiology (23 papers), Cardiac pacing and defibrillation studies (19 papers),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(14 papers) and Blood Pressure and Hypertension Studies (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(2.3k citations), Hematology (654 citations), Aging (96 citations), Physiology (1.3k citations) and Pathology and Forensic Medicine (631 citations). M Condorelli has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and Denmark. Frequent co-authors include Gianni Marone, Bruno Trimarco, Massimo Chiariello, Claudio Napoli, M Chiariello, Giuseppe Ambrosio, C Peschle, Massimo Volpe, Filomena de Nigris and Paolo Golino. Their work appears in journals such as The American Journal of Cardiology, Circulation, American Heart Journal, International Journal of Cardiology and Cardiology.
